Scope The Grant Writer at IMEG Corporation will play a pivotal role focused on researching and preparing grant applications to secure funding needed to meet the diverse needs of IMEG clients. The Grant Writer will conduct thorough online research to demonstrate the need for funding, which is crucial for the preparation of persuasive and high-quality written funding requests. These requests must align with the requirements set forth by various agencies. The Grant Writer will also be responsible for reviewing and understanding financial documents to prepare budgets that meet the stringent requirements of funding agencies. Principal Responsibilities Research and identify potential funding opportunities from government agencies, foundations, and other sources. Advise clients as needed on available funding and potentially eligible projects. Collaborate with clients to identify needs and gather relevant data for proposals, including program development details and budgeting information. Perform online research to identify supportive information to be used as documentation for grant applications. Complete high-quality written funding requests which address identified client needs and meet funding agency requirements. Maintain accurate records of grant submissions, deadlines, and reporting requirements. Proofread and edit proposals to ensure clarity, coherence, and adherence to funder guidelines. Build relationships with funders and stakeholders to enhance fundraising efforts. Possible planning related duties Stay informed about trends in grant funding and best practices in proposal writing. Required Skills/Abilities A strong understanding of community development planning, budgeting, and fundraising strategies Ability to complete application forms and documents with minimal guidance. Effective communication to liaise internally with team members and externally with clients as part of a large integrated team. Strong skills in program development, budgeting, and financial report writing. Excellent proofreading and editing skills with keen attention to detail. Strong organizational skills with the ability to meet deadlines under pressure. Education and Experience Master’s degree in public administration, planning, or a closely related field. Proven experience in proposal writing and plan preparation. Familiarity and experience developing successful applications for Federal agencies (i.e. Economic Development Administration, Department of Housing & Urban Development, U.S. Department of Agriculture, Federal Highway Administration). Experience with grant writing for Tribal communities and programs including Tribal Transit Plans and Comprehensive Plans.
